Finance Alum, Damian Wille, Paving the Way for LGBTQIA+ Future Leaders in Financial Services

Our Diversity Matters feature this week highlights DePaul alum, Damian Wille. Damian is a 2017 graduate of the business school, who is from a small town outside of Appleton, Wisconsin.  Damian chose DePaul because of the hands-on experience the business school offers students along with the proximity and access to Chicago’s financial district. Majoring in Finance and minoring in Accounting, Damian was able to gain a good understanding of the finance industry and the importance of having strong accounting and financial modeling skills. During his time at DePaul, he was very involved in cocurricular activities, with leadership roles in the DePaul Investment Group, Student Government Association, and even as a production manager for theatre companies in Chicago–all while juggling school and internships! 

Damian had a few different internships during his time at DePaul, all helping him acquire technical and professional skills that he still uses today. In one of his internships, Damian was able to pitch stocks directly to the portfolio manager which allowed for him to network and give concrete examples of how he was involved in his company. After graduating, Damian started at Jefferies as an Equity Research Associate. After a few years at Jefferies, his entire team was lifted out to Barclays, where he is now an Assistant Vice President in Equity Research. In his role, Damian helps institutional investors select stocks to invest in within the Payments and Fintech sectors. His day-to-day work consists of writing research reports, creating financial models, interacting with investment professionals, and deducing complex data. Another part of his work is helping private companies go public and organizing the Barclays Fintech Conference, which comes with organizing many meetings. Along with his busy work schedule, Damian also is on the Advisory Board for the Driehaus Center for Behavioral Finance at DePaul and also recently was a guest discussion leader for an LGBTQ+ event hosted by th
e DePaul Department of Finance and Real Estate.

During Damian’s experiences in financial services, Damian has learned that the key to success is being authentic. As a part of the LGBTQ+ community, Damian has realized that being your true self is the best way to connect with people and start conversations. During his time at Jefferies, Damian was able to work with a senior executive at the company and help start the LGBTQ+ employee resource group at the firm. Damian’s advice for students is to get involved in clubs that interest you and start early with professional networking! LinkedIn is just one example of taking advantage of useful resources since it is easy to find DePaul alumni who are more than willing to have conversations and provide mentorship.
